Sash Window Draught Proofing: A Comprehensive Guide
Sash windows, a trademark of conventional architecture, are esteemed for their visual appeal and functionality. However, they typically come with the significant downside of draughts, which can jeopardize energy effectiveness and comfort in homes. Draught proofing sash windows is essential for preserving heat, reducing energy expenses, and improving the life expectancy of the windows themselves. This short article delves into approaches, materials, and benefits of draught proofing sash windows, using homeowners the insight they require to enhance their living areas effectively.
Understanding Sash Windows
Sash windows are vertical sliding windows consisted of multiple panes of glass framed by wood or, significantly, PVC. Their design enables much better ventilation and light penetration than other window types. However, their age and traditional building and construction frequently lead to spaces and cracks, leading to heat loss.

Draught-proofing can be carried out utilizing various strategies and materials tailored to the specifics of the sash window. Below are the most typical methods:
1. Weatherstripping
Weatherstripping involves applying a strip of product around the window's frame to create a seal. This technique is versatile and can accommodate varying gap sizes.
Kinds of Weatherstripping:Felt: Inexpensive and easy to apply however not really resilient.Vinyl: Offers better insulation and is more weather-resistant.Foam Tape: A simple, self-adhesive choice that supplies great insulation.2. Draught Excluders
Draught excluders are products positioned at the base of the window sill to prevent cold air from entering. These can be long-term or detachable, depending upon personal choice.
Alternatives Include:PVC Draught Excluders: Affordable and efficient for long-term usage.Fabric Draught Excluders: These can include a decorative component while serving their practical purpose.3. Secondary Glazing
Secondary glazing includes setting up a 2nd layer of glazing to develop an insulating barrier. This not only lowers draughts however also improves soundproofing and thermal effectiveness.
Advantages of Secondary Glazing:Lower setup costs compared to complete window replacement.Increased insulation without modifying the appearance of the original sash window.4. Insulating Paint
While not a direct kind of draught proofing, insulating paint can be applied to the window frame to minimize heat transfer. This technique is less common but beneficial for improving overall window efficiency.
5. Window Films
Window movies can improve insulation and lower glare. These films are simple to apply and can provide extra UV defense.
Step-by-Step Guide to Draught Proofing Sash Windows
Below is a simplified step-by-step guide for homeowners thinking about draught proofing their sash windows:
Step 1: Assess the GapsDetermine locations where air is dripping. This can be done by running your hand around the window frame or using a candle light to discover drafts.Action 2: Clean the AreaEnsure that the areas around the window frames are tidy and devoid of particles to guarantee correct adhesion of products.Step 3: Choose Your MethodSelect the suitable draught-proofing approach or combination of methods based upon the size of gaps and spending plan.Step 4: Install WeatherstrippingApply the chosen weatherstripping around the window frames, following the producer's guidelines for finest outcomes.Step 5: Position Draught ExcludersLocation draught excluders at the base of the window sill if necessary, guaranteeing a tight fit.Step 6: Regular MaintenancePeriodically examine the window seals and Draught excluders to ensure they remain reliable.
